VALPOI: Murmure villages in Guleli panchayat area of Sattari taluka have been facing shortage of drinking water for the last six days. The Public Works Department (PWD) is negligent in repairing the damaged pipeline that has cut off the water supply, claim the villagers. The trip of one tanker, sent for 70 houses, to ease the drinking water shortage in the village does not serve the purpose.
The villagers allege that complaints made in this regard are being ignored. The enraged villagers marched on the water supply office in Valpoi on Tuesday and expressed their resentment. The villagers have warned to take out Ghagari Morcha on Wednesday, if the drinking water facility is not restored by Tuesday night.
Briefing on the issue, former Sarpanch and villager Rohidas Gavkar reiterates that despite multiple complaints no action in fixing the pipe was noticed. Gavkar alleged that the concerned officers were not cooperating.
Gavkar said the government announced 16,000 Litres of free water for each month but in villages like Murmure, only fifty litres of water is available in two days.
The villagers had reached the PWD office at 10 am. However, the officers of the office were found missing till 11.30 am.
